Clifton Hicks - I Saw a Man at the Close of Day (Drunkard's Doom) Gourd Banjo
This video features Clifton Hicks performing the song "Drunkard's Doom" (also known as "I Saw a Man at the Close of Day") on a 5-string gourd banjo made in Jamaica by Jeff Menzies. Hicks learned the song from Matt Kinman and provides the lyrics in the description. The song tells a cautionary tale about alcoholism.
